What gmail add digital signature means
A gmail add digital signature is a way to sign documents sent through Gmail using an electronic signature workflow, often with signNow. The sender attaches a document, routes it for signature, and the recipient signs from a secure link or embedded signing flow. The process records signer identity, timestamps, and document activity, creating a clear record of who signed, when they signed, and what was signed.
Why it matters legally
It reduces turnaround time, keeps approvals inside email, and supports enforceability under ESIGN and UETA when consent, intent, and record retention are handled correctly.

Common signing pain points
Recipients may miss the signing request if the Gmail thread is buried or forwarded without context. Attachments can be edited after sending unless the workflow seals the document and preserves the audit trail. Identity checks can be too weak for higher-risk transactions if only email access is used. Retention gaps can make it harder to prove consent, intent, and document integrity later.

How the signing flow works
The process follows a simple sequence from email delivery to completed, recorded signature.
Prepare: The sender creates the document and starts the signing request from Gmail. Route: signNow sends a secure signing link or embedded request to the recipient. Sign: The signer reviews, signs, and completes the document on any device. Record: The completed file and activity record are stored for later review.

FAQ and troubleshooting
These answers focus on plan limits, compliance needs, and workflow issues that affect Gmail-based signing.
signNow Business includes legally binding eSignatures, audit trails, templates, mobile apps, and unlimited users on paid plans. If a request is not tracking correctly, confirm the document was sent through the signed workflow and not as a plain attachment.
For HIPAA workflows, signNow supports HIPAA compliance with a BAA. The signed record should be retained for 6 years under 45 CFR 164.530(j)(2), and access controls should protect PHI throughout the process.
signNow Business Premium adds bulk send, while Enterprise adds advanced signer authentication and formula fields. If you need mass routing from Gmail, check whether the plan includes the feature before sending multiple requests.
All major vendors in this space support ESIGN and UETA, but the evidentiary value depends on the audit trail, signer intent, and retention. signNow records timestamps and document history to support later review.
If a signer cannot open the request, confirm the browser is current and that Chrome, Firefox, Safari, or Edge is supported. Mobile signing also works on iOS and Android through signNow apps.
